Pioneer Ridge Nature Area & Nature Center

This two-story nature center, with displays and a full-time naturalist, has three stocked ponds open for public fishing. There are also 15 miles of hiking, biking and horseback-riding trails and a half-mile paved, handicapped-accessible trail.

American Gothic House

Iowa artist Grant Wood sketched this house on a 1930 visit and that summer painted it as the background for his world-famous painting, "American Gothic." Listed on the National Register of Historic Places.

Rathbun Lake Information Center

Displays on coal mining, wildlife diorama, lake history and current information on the Rathbun Lake area.

Pella Rolscreen Museum

Former rail passenger depot houses a variety of exhibits about Pella Corporation, formerly known as the Rolscreen Company, manufacturer of premium-quality windows and doors.

Belinda Toy and Antique Museum

Historic 1846 church has been transformed into a toy museum, with collections of airplanes, cars, tractors, dolls, trains, and tin and cast-iron toys.
